Comprehending Sash Windows
Sash windows include 2 or more frames that slide vertically to open and close. They are mainly made from wood, which provides their characteristic appeal but likewise makes them vulnerable to weathering, rot, and other issues in time.
Common Issues with Sash WindowsRotting Wood: Wooden frames are vulnerable to decay if they end up being damp or are sporadically preserved.Broken Glass: Accidental effects or extreme climate condition can result in broken or shattered panes.Drafts and Poor Insulation: Over the years, the seals around sash windows can break down, causing air leakages and reduced energy efficiency.Sash Jamming: Paint buildup, warping, or particles can cause the window sashes to stick.Balance Problems: The counterweights utilized to hold the window in place can stop working, making it difficult to open or close the sashes.Value of Prompt Repairs
Disregarding sash window repairs can result in more extensive damage and higher repair expenses down the line. Regular maintenance and prompt interventions not only preserve the aesthetic appeal of the windows however also improve energy efficiency, which can contribute to lower heating expenses.

The cost of Sash Window Refurbishing Company window repairs can vary widely based upon the level of the damage, place, and specific services required. Below is a basic breakdown of possible costs you might experience:
Repair TypeTypical Cost (GBP)Minor Repairs (e.g., fixing jams, little wood rot)₤ 150 - ₤ 300Glass Replacement₤ 200 - ₤ 500 per paneComplete Sash Restoration₤ 300 - ₤ 800 per sashDraught Proofing₤ 150 - ₤ 400 per windowComplete Rebuild₤ 800 - ₤ 2,000 per windowAspects Influencing CostSize of the Window: Larger windows might require more materials and labor.Area: Prices can differ considerably based on geographical location and season.Product Quality: Higher-quality restoration products can increase the final expense.Labor Costs: Hiring experienced professionals might cost more however typically leads to much better outcomes.FAQs About Sash Window Repairs1.
